Project Overview:

Bechtel has been appointed as the Delivery Partner, supporting our customer Metrolinx as part of an integrated team, to help deliver the signature Ontario Line Subway (OLS) Project, a transformational transit project for the Greater Toronto Area. The multi-billion-dollar project scope includes the design build, operations and maintenance of all infrastructure and rail systems associated with 15 stations and over 15km of new alignment.

The Project Controls Analyst will be part of the South Civil work package team delivering seven (7) new stations and six (6) kilometers of twin bore tunnel between Exhibition Station and the Don Valley in the heart of downtown Toronto. The works are already well into the construction phase.

Job Summary:

The Ontario Line Delivery Partner is currently seeking a Project Controls Analyst with experience in multiple disciplines of Project Controls, quantification, planning, cost, risk and reporting. Project Controls Analyst will report directly to the Project Controls Manager for South Civil. Although principally an office-based role, Project Controls Analyst is expected to visit project sites for firsthand view of the works in progress both above ground and up to 40m below ground in the caverns and tunnels of the works, which will require access via ladders and stairtowers. #LI-ML1

About Bechtel

Bechtel Corporation is an American engineering, procurement, construction, and project management company founded in San Francisco, California, and headquartered in Reston, Virginia. It is the largest construction company in the United States and the 11th-largest privately owned American company in 2018. Its headquarters are in the Reston area of unincorporated Fairfax County, Virginia. Bechtel is a global engineering, construction, and project management company, and they are currently working on projects in over 40 countries. The company is organized into five global business units that specialize in civil infrastructure; power generation, communications, and transmission; mining and metals; oil, gas, and chemicals; and government services.
